Transaction 07a8f1680a335641c19b995359befe672dfbba05faad2aa1cf74cb709f823a90
1 Input
1 Output
-
07a8f1680a335641c19b995359befe672dfbba05faad2aa1cf74cb709f823a90:0
- value
- 50419450
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ea4824411818b6342c039bfbf40c5cde2ba71eb OP_EQUAL
- address
- MDcPCbhR4aqSCTs5fo8YU8GrmrHTBF8E7a